This heartwarming story explains why my sister, Lisa, and the girl are smiling in the photo to the left. Lisa’s business sells fashionable hand-crafted accessories and more, and she exhibits at a number of festivals held in the Sarasota/Bradenton, FL area.
The girl and her mother, who were on vacation, were distraught when they first met Lisa. They told her that at the first booth they visited, the vendor made it clear that the child was not welcome, stating her jewelry was for “adults only”. The girl later saw a charm that said “Karma” at another booth and asked for the meaning. The mother wrote this post on the event’s Facebook page: “Shortly later, we met this sweet lady in the picture, and in conversation, I told her about the earlier experience. She said my daughter was welcome to try all her items. And, as a kind gesture, gave her this pretty necklace to match her shirt, which was handmade by her parents (who are in their 80s!). Everyone complimented her on it the rest of the day - I told my daughter this is a good example of Karma!”
Lisa said that our parents taught us to “do something good for someone every day!" Lisa gave a necklace to the girl that matched the flamingo birds on her shirt. Her mother encouraged her daughter to thank her, and she gave Lisa a shy little hug. Lisa continued: “About a half hour later the little girl appeared in our booth, as she wanted to give me a big hug again for the necklace. Her Mom came up and expressed that everyone loved the Flamingo necklace on her, and she was so thrilled with it. Yes, my heart was totally touched!”

Ahh-Mazing “AHA!” Discovery for April 2017: Area of Most Lightning Strikes in the World
We have been told for years that the Tampa Bay Area, located on the Gulf of Mexico Coast of Florida and where Watt-Ahh® is bottled, qualifies as the “Lightning Capital of the World.” This distinction may or may not be accurate. It seems Tampa’s sparky competition lies within the vicinity of Lake Maracaibo, located within the northwestern portion of Venezuela. It is estimated over 1.2 million lightning strikes occur in a year, and some lightning episodes can last for up to ten consecutive hours. Part of the history and folklore include the belief by ancient indigenous people that the lightning was triggered when fireflies encountered the ancestral spirits.
